好文档就是一把金锄头!
欢迎来到金锄头文库![会员中心]
电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本

溯源信息可追溯性与不可篡改性的实现.docx

23页
  • 卖家[上传人]:I***
  • 文档编号:428156692
  • 上传时间:2024-03-26
  • 文档格式:DOCX
  • 文档大小:39.07KB
  • / 23 举报 版权申诉 马上下载
  • 文本预览
  • 下载提示
  • 常见问题
    • 溯源信息可追溯性与不可篡改性的实现 第一部分 信息可追溯性的技术基础 2第二部分 信息不可篡改性的机制实现 5第三部分 分布式账本技术在可追溯性的应用 7第四部分 智能合约在不可篡改性中的作用 10第五部分 密码学算法在信息保护中的应用 12第六部分 共识机制对可追溯性和不可篡改性的影响 15第七部分 区块链技术在溯源体系中的优势 18第八部分 溯源信息可追溯性与不可篡改性的实际应用场景 21第一部分 信息可追溯性的技术基础关键词关键要点区块链1. 分布式账本技术,使数据透明、不可篡改,增强可追溯性2. 共识机制,确保交易记录的真实性和一致性3. 智能合约,实现自动执行和数据验证,提高可追溯性准确性哈希算法1. 单向加密函数,将数据转换为唯一且不可逆的哈希值2. 任何数据变更都会导致哈希值发生变化,从而实现数据完整性3. 允许快速高效地验证数据是否被篡改数字签名1. 使用密码学算法将消息和签名密钥关联,生成唯一的数字签名2. 验证签名者身份,确保数据的真实性3. 如果数据被篡改,数字签名将失效,从而实现不可篡改时间戳服务1. 提供可信的时间标记,记录数据创建或修改的时间。

      2. 防止数据回滚或篡改,确保可追溯性的时间顺序3. 通过独立第三方机构颁发时间戳,增强可追溯性的可靠性数据加密1. 使用加密算法对数据进行加密,防止未经授权的访问2. 加密密钥和解密算法控制数据访问,确保数据机密性3. 增强可追溯数据在存储和传输过程中的安全性分布式存储1. 将数据分布存储在多个节点上,提高数据冗余和可用性2. 结合区块链或哈希算法,确保数据的不可篡改性和可靠性3. 避免单点故障,增强可追溯数据系统稳定性和安全性信息可追溯性的技术基础区块链技术* 分布式账本:信息记录在多个节点上,每个节点持有所有交易的完整副本 不可篡改性:一旦信息被添加到区块链中,就无法对其进行修改或删除 透明度:所有交易对所有人都可见,增强了可追溯性和问责制哈希函数* 单向函数:将任意长度的数据转换为固定长度的哈希值 抗碰撞性:不可能找到具有相同哈希值的两个不同的输入 用于验证信息的完整性:将哈希值存储在区块链中,并将其与原始信息进行比较以检测篡改时间戳技术* 记录事件发生时间:将数字签名和时间戳附加到交易或事件上 证明交易顺序:时间戳可建立交易的顺序,便于识别篡改或欺诈行为数字签名* 加密算法:使用非对称加密密钥对信息进行签名。

      身份认证:签名证明签名者是在其私钥拥有者的身份下进行签名 不可否认性:签名者无法否认其签名,加强了可追溯性和问责制证书颁发机构 (CA)* 信任锚:发布和验证数字证书的受信任实体 数字证书:包含个体或组织身份以及公钥的信息 身份验证:验证证书中指定的身份,并通过公钥加密确保通信的安全性生物识别技术* 独特的身特征:指纹、虹膜扫描和面部识别等技术用于个人身份识别 不可篡改性:身体特征随着时间的推移而保持相对稳定,难以伪造或修改 安全访问控制:允许对敏感信息和其他资源进行安全访问,同时防止未经授权的访问物联网 (IoT) 设备* 连接性:将物理设备连接到网络,以便监视、控制和数据收集 传感器和数据采集:收集有关设备操作、环境条件和用户交互的信息 远程访问:通过网络远程控制和监控设备,增强可追溯性和问责制数据分析和可视化* 数据收集和分析:从多个来源收集和分析数据,以识别趋势、模式和异常情况 可视化仪表板:通过交互式仪表板和报表呈现可追溯性数据,便于理解和决策制定 警报和通知:在检测到异常或可疑活动时触发警报和通知,实现快速响应和预防措施其他技术* 数据水印:将隐形标识符嵌入到数字内容中,以便跟踪其来源和使用情况。

      数字取证:分析电子设备、数据存储和通信记录,查找证据并重建事件 人工智能 (AI):利用机器学习算法自动检测和分析可追溯性数据,提高效率和准确性第二部分 信息不可篡改性的机制实现关键词关键要点主题名称:加密算法1. 利用散列函数或哈希算法生成消息摘要,实现不可篡改性2. 采用数字签名技术,通过非对称加密算法生成数字签名,保证消息的完整性3. 应用对称加密算法,通过密钥加密消息,使得未经授权的访问者无法查看消息内容主题名称:区块链技术信息不可篡改性的机制实现信息不可篡改性是区块链技术的重要特征之一,确保数据一旦写入区块链后,任何人都无法对其进行篡改实现信息不可篡改性的机制主要有以下几种:哈希函数哈希函数是一种单向函数,它将任意长度的数据映射到固定长度的哈希值该哈希值是数据本身的唯一指纹,即使对数据进行微小的修改,其哈希值也会发生显著变化在区块链中,每个区块都包含前一个区块的哈希值当新区块被添加到链中时,其哈希值会被计算并添加到下一个区块中如果攻击者试图篡改某个区块的数据,哈希值就会发生变化,这将导致链断开,从而无法继续添加新区块工作量证明(PoW)工作量证明是一种共识机制,它要求矿工解决复杂的数学难题来验证交易和生成新区块。

      为了解决这些难题,矿工需要消耗大量的计算能力和电力哈希函数和工作量证明相结合产生了数字签名每个区块包含一个数字签名,该签名是通过对区块哈希值应用矿工的私钥而生成的如果攻击者试图篡改区块,数字签名将无效,这将导致区块被拒绝,从而保护区块链的完整性分布式账本区块链是一种分布式账本,它被复制到网络中众多节点上这意味着每个节点都保存着区块链的完整副本如果攻击者试图篡改某个节点上的区块链,其他节点将拒绝该改动,因为它们知道该改动是无效的分布式账本能有效防止单点故障和篡改,因为它要求攻击者同时控制网络中的大多数节点,这在实践中几乎是不可能的时间戳时间戳是一种机制,它记录交易或事件发生的时间在区块链中,每个区块都包含一个时间戳当区块被添加到链中时,其时间戳会被永久记录下来时间戳可用于防止重放攻击,即攻击者试图使用旧交易来欺骗系统如果攻击者试图重放旧交易,该交易将被拒绝,因为其时间戳与当前时间不匹配此外,以下机制也可以增强信息不可篡改性:* 智能合约:智能合约是运行在区块链上的自治程序它们可以用来执行特定任务,例如验证交易或管理资产智能合约的代码是不可篡改的,这有助于防止未经授权的更改 共识算法:共识算法是区块链网络中达成共识并验证交易所需的机制。

      不同的共识算法,如工作量证明和权益证明,都提供了不同的信息不可篡改性级别 密钥管理:密钥管理是保护私钥和公钥的安全,以及确保只有授权用户才能访问和修改区块链的至关重要方面通过结合这些机制,区块链技术能够实现高度的信息不可篡改性,从而为各种行业提供可靠且可信赖的解决方案第三部分 分布式账本技术在可追溯性的应用关键词关键要点分布式账本技术在增强供应链中可追溯性的应用1. 分布式账本技术提供了一个不变性且透明的记录系统,使供应链参与者能够安全地记录和共享交易数据,从而提高可追溯性2. 借助智能合约,分布式账本技术可以自动化流程,确保交易在满足预定义条件时执行,从而提高效率和透明度3. 分布式账本技术的去中心化特性消除了中心化控制点,从而降低了数据操纵或篡改的风险,增强了数据的可信度分布式账本技术在医疗保健中可追溯性的应用1. 分布式账本技术可以通过提供患者医疗记录的详细且防篡改的审计跟踪,提高医疗保健中的可追溯性2. 它可以通过连接不同的医疗保健利益相关者,例如医院、药房和保险公司,实现药物追溯,确保药物的安全性和有效性3. 分布式账本技术可以促进医疗研究,通过提供安全且透明的平台来收集和共享敏感的患者数据,从而有助于发现和开发新的治疗方法。

      分布式账本技术在可追溯性的应用分布式账本技术(DLT)以其去中心化、不可篡改和透明的特点,成为实现信息可追溯性的有力工具DLT 通过创建一个共享且不可变的账本,将交易数据以加密和分散的方式记录下来,从而确保了数据的真实性、完整性和可审计性可追溯性的实现DLT 在可追溯性方面的应用涉及以下几个关键要素:* 数据记录:所有相关交易数据(如产品来源、加工过程、运输记录)都以时间戳的方式记录在分布式账本上 透明度:账本对所有授权参与者开放,允许他们查看和验证交易记录 不可篡改性:一旦交易被记录在账本上,它将被加密并链接到前一个交易,形成一个不可改变的链条任何试图篡改数据的行为都会破坏链条的完整性,并被其他参与者检测到 审计跟踪:每个交易都包含时间戳、交易方和交易详细信息等审计跟踪信息,以便进行全面审计不可篡改性的保证DLT 的不可篡改性主要通过以下机制实现:* 共识机制:DLT 使用共识机制(如工作量证明或权益证明)来验证交易并达成共识只有获得网络中大多数参与者批准的交易才能被添加到账本中 加密哈希函数:每个交易都使用加密哈希函数进行哈希处理,生成一个唯一的哈希值哈希值与前一个交易的哈希值链接,形成一个加密链条。

      分布式存储:交易数据分布式存储在网络中的多个节点上,而不是集中存储在一个中央服务器上这消除了单点故障的风险,确保了数据的安全性应用场景DLT 已被广泛应用于各种行业,以增强可追溯性和不可篡改性,包括:* 供应链管理:追踪商品从原材料到成品的整个生命周期,确保产品来源真实、生产过程安全 食品安全:监测食品从农场到餐桌的处理过程,确保食物安全和质量 药品追溯:跟踪药品从制造商到分销商和零售商的流通,防止假冒药品流通 医疗保健:记录患者病历、药物处方和医疗程序,确保患者护理的可追溯性和安全性 金融服务:记录和验证金融交易,提高透明度和减少欺诈风险优势与挑战DLT 在可追溯性方面的应用带来了诸多优势,包括:* 增强信任度和透明度* 提高决策制定效率* 减少欺诈和错误* 保护消费者和品牌声誉然而,DLT 的应用也面临着一些挑战,如:* 可扩展性:随着参与者和交易数量的增加,DLT 系统的可扩展性可能成为问题 隐私 concerns:虽然 DLT 提供了透明度,但它也可能暴露敏感数据,引发 privacy 方面的担忧 监管环境:DLT 的监管环境仍在发展中,需要明确的法律和法规来确保其安全和合规性。

      结论分布式账本技术为实现信息可追溯性和不可篡改性提供了一个创新且有前途的解决方案通过利用共识机制、加密哈希函数和分布式存储,DLT 确保了交易数据的真实性、完整性和审计性随着技术的发展和监管环境的成熟,DLT 在各个行业的应用有望进一步增长,推动透明度、信任和问责制第四部分 智能合约在不可篡改性中的作用智能合约在不可篡改性中的作用在区块链技术中,不可篡改性是一个至关重要的属性,它确保了记录在区块链上的交易和数据具有不可逆转性和难以更改的特性智能合约在这方面发挥着至关重要的作用智能合约概述智能合约是存储在区块链网络上的计算机程序,它们按照预定的规则自动执行合约条款这些合约通常以确定性的方式运行,这意味着给定相同的输入,它们将始终产生相同的结果不可篡改性的实现机制智能合约实现不可篡改性主要有以下机制:* 密码学哈希函数: 智能合约代码和数据使用密码学哈。

      点击阅读更多内容
      关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
      手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
      ©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.